#e420ea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e420ea is composed of 89.4% red, 12.5%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.6% cyan, 86.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 298.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 52.2%. #e420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40ff with #c900d5.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#e420ea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e420ea has RGB values of R:228, G:32,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 14950634.

Shades and Tints of #e420ea
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010a is the darkest color, while #fef7fe is the lightest one.
